Adobe Photoshop is one of the most powerful digital image editing program ever developed. Originaly created for photo retouching, color correction, prepress services, illustration and other visual design activities, has now expanded to cover new areas such as web design, digital photography, digital video and 3d rendering, .
Adobe Photoshop standard tools and commands are straightforward to learn, but it is in their interaction where the magic lies. Better Night Photography TipsCategory: Photo retouching The key to successful night photography lies in a long exposure. We’re talking about exposures measured in seconds. When a long exposure is used, more light is allowed into the camera, allowing the details in your night photo to be captured. The problem with using long exposures is that you may shake the camera, resulting in poor pictures. The way around this is to use a tripod.
